[diffoscope] Support for Mach-O comparator

Clemens Lang cal at macports.org
Wed Dec 2 17:12:03 CET 2015


Hi,

please find attached two patches that implement support for comparing Mach-O
binaries as used on OS X beyond just a binary diff, together with tests for
them.

Note that the comparator needs the otool(1) and lipo(1) tools from Apple's
toolchain, so you will probably not be able to run these tests on Linux. I
have run them on OS X 10.11 where they pass without issues.

Please excuse the use of attachments, I don't have a better mail setup that
would allow me to send them inline at my hands at the moment.


Best regards,
-- 
Clemens Lang for MacPorts
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0001-Add-comparator-for-OS-X-binary-files.patch
Type: text/x-patch
Size: 6223 bytes
Desc: not available
URL: <http://lists.reproducible-builds.org/pipermail/diffoscope/attachments/20151202/4349a7a8/attachment.bin>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0002-Add-tests-for-OS-X-binary-comparator.patch
Type: text/x-patch
Size: 10712 bytes
Desc: not available
URL: <http://lists.reproducible-builds.org/pipermail/diffoscope/attachments/20151202/4349a7a8/attachment-0001.bin>


More information about the diffoscope mailing list